Aboard the Underground Railroad: A National Register Travel Itinerary

This site is dedicated to the "Underground Railway", the route established in an effort to assist persons held in bondage in North America to escape from slavery. The site features an introduction text, maps, information on people involved and stations of the underground railroad, as well as a bibliography on the subject.
